DNA methylation of channel-related genes in cancers
چکیده انگلیسی


• Epigenetic alterations of ionic channel-related genes may contribute to carcinogenesis via regulating their expression.
• Hypermethylation of ion channel gene promoter is frequent in cancer where it is associated with loss of their expression.
• Hypomethylation of ion channels is less frequent than hypermethylation, and is associated with increase of their expression.
• Ion channel methylation status is often associated with a poor prognosis, and may be potentially used as a prognostic factor.

DNA methylation at CpG sites is an epigenetic mechanism that regulates cellular gene expression. In cancer cells, aberrant methylation is correlated with the abnormalities in expression of genes that are known to be involved in the particular characteristics of cancer cells such as proliferation, apoptosis, migration or invasion. During the past 30 years, accumulating data have definitely convinced the scientific community that ion channels are involved in cancerogenesis and cancer properties. As they are situated at the cell surface, they might be prime targets in the development of new therapeutic strategies besides their potential use as prognostic factors. Despite the progress in our understanding of the remodeling of ion channels in cancer cells, the molecular mechanisms underlying their over- or down-expression remained enigmatic. In this review, we aimed to summarize the available data on gene promoter methylation of ion channels and to investigate their clinical significance as novel biomarkers in cancer.
